Basic copy paper is the most extensively utilized type in offices. It is versatile and ideal for daily printing jobs, consisting of letters, memos, and documents. Typically weighing between 70 to 90 GSM and with a brightness of 92 to 100, it provides a good balance of cost and quality.
Premium Copy Paper
Premium copy paper is created for jobs that need a premium surface. With a weight ranging from 90 to 120 GSM and a brightness that frequently exceeds 98, this paper is ideal for printing reports, presentations, and any documents where first impressions matter.
Eco-Friendly Paper
As sustainability becomes increasingly important, environmentally friendly paper alternatives have gained popularity. These papers are made from recycled materials and have comparable weight and brightness to basic paper. They use an ecologically responsible way to produce difficult copies while preserving quality.
Colored Copy Paper
Colored copy paper can make documents stand apart and include an innovative touch. It is usually readily available in a variety of weights and colors and is frequently used for leaflets, posters, and various innovative jobs.
Cardstock
Cardstock is a heavier paper option, normally ranging from 150 to 300 GSM. It is thicker than basic copy paper and is ideal for service cards, invitations, leaflets, and other tasks that require durability.
Key Considerations When Choosing Copy Paper
When picking the ideal copy paper for your workplace needs, a number of aspects should be taken into consideration:
Weight: The weight of the paper impacts its sturdiness and viability for different printing jobs. Lighter papers are much better for daily files, while much heavier stock is needed for premium prints.
Brightness: The brightness of the paper can impact readability and the vibrancy of printed colors. Greater brightness levels are helpful for color printing.
Opacity: This describes how transparent the paper is. Higher opacity minimizes the chance of text revealing through, which is important for double-sided printing.
End up: The surface of the paper impacts how ink sticks to it. Glossy surfaces are ideal for images, while matte finishes work better for text-heavy documents.
Ecological Impact: Choosing environmentally friendly alternatives can boost your business's sustainability efforts.

Can I use colored copy paper in all printers?
While a lot of printers can manage colored copy paper, it is vital to check the manufacturer's standards, specifically for inkjet printers, as heavy or textured paper can cause jams.
2. What is the best weight for daily printing?
Standard copy paper with a weight of 80 GSM is typically suggested for everyday printing jobs. It strikes a balance between quality and cost-effectiveness.
3. Is recycled paper suitable for premium printing?
Yes, many recycled documents are designed to supply excellent print quality and can be used for top quality files. Try to find premium recycled choices for better results.
4. How do I determine the brightness level I require?
For general workplace usage, a brightness of 92 to 98 is usually sufficient. However, for colorful presentations or graphics, objective for papers with brightness levels of 100 or more.
5. What should I do if my paper jams often?
If paper jams are a persistent concern, check the following: ensure the paper is stored properly, use the correct paper type and weight, and verify that the printer is well-maintained and complimentary from particles.
